India, Aug. 5 -- The Andhra Pradesh government is aiming to attract investments of up to Rs 9 lakh crore across various sectors in the VER.

As part of the Visakhapatnam Economic Region project, the state government plans to invest between Rs 3.5 lakh crore and Rs 4 lakh crore, and attract up to Rs 5.3 lakh crore from the private sector, a press release said on Wednesday, August 5.
